Teaching in the university could be challenging and requires practice for newly PhD holders who joins the academia. This course required me to teach one class by substituting one of the faculty for a course that intersect with my specialty or experience. I delivered a class to ME 391 students. The class objectives included examining three types of behavior for unforced Mass Spring Damper (M-S-D) system and introducing the forced M-S-D system and resonance in mechanical systems.

Before this lecture, I prepared several questions for the students to trigger their thinking. I connected the class content with an application they see everyday. For instance, the door closer mechanism is a an example for a critically damped system, which can be manually adjusted to control the damping ratio.

What I learned after giving this class that students like to change activity in the class. There are various and many activities that the lecturer can initiate such as: playing a video that support a presented information, asking questions with think pair and share strategy, or providing clicker questions. This is much more effective compared to a long lecturing period where students are more likely to loose concentration.

I selected the topic of effective teaching. Effective teaching can be incorporated in classes in several ways. I delivered a presentation on "Effective Teaching Methods in Large Classes".

In this presentation, I discussed the question: Is lecturing effective?

In 1976, a study by Johnstone, Alex H., and Frederick Percival determined that students needed a three- to five-minute period of settling down, which would be followed by 10 to 18 minutes of optimal focus. Then — no matter how good the teacher or how compelling the subject matter — there would come a lapse. In the vernacular, the students would “lose it.” The study was done before the age of texting and tweeting; presumably, the attention spans of younger people today have become even shorter. Thus, changing activity within the class is essential for the students' engagement.

I also introduced the advantages of small and large classes. It was shown that small size classes enable teachers to be more effective, and research has shown that children who attend small classes in the early grades continue to benefit over their entire lifetime”. On the other hand, large classes promote competition with more students and expose the students to more ideas and insights.

Furthermore, I presented ways to increase the teaching effectiveness in the classes such as

  1. Requiring the students to study the lecture material before class and using Entrance and & Exit tickets to assess their pre and post understanding.
  2. Changing activity
  3. Recap! This was shown to increase the students retention.

Finally, I presented ways to deal with disruptive students. Examples include

  1. Try to physically move to the part of the room where the students are, and continue to lead the class whilst standing next to them.
  2. Direct a question to the area in which the noisy students are sitting. This focuses attention on that area of the class.
  3. Try speaking more quietly. This causes the noisy students to become more obvious in contrast and other students may ask them to quieten down.
